Transaction 7224a0921da8ca24f990311ff089990576c153a439f43d8b1555301416160613
1 Input
1 Output
-
7224a0921da8ca24f990311ff089990576c153a439f43d8b1555301416160613:0
- value
- 670530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14ee204b03951650d04ee7e2b20041f01bb41fce OP_EQUAL
- address
- 33bghg6nKj9WkdEaNScbXUqs5MHVLCbzYi